Overview
SMBJ20AHM3_B/H from Vishay General Semiconductor is a unidirectional surface-mount transient voltage suppressor (TVS) diode in SMB (DO-214AA) package, designed for clamping inductive switching transients and ESD events on power and signal lines. It features 22.2 V minimum breakdown voltage (VBR), 20 V maximum stand-off voltage (VWM), 32.4 V clamping voltage (VC) at 18.5 A peak pulse current, and 600 W peak pulse power rating with 10/1000 µs waveform - used in automotive sensor protection and industrial I/O interface circuits.
For engineers reviewing the SMBJ20AHM3_B/H datasheet, SMBJ20AHM3_B/H pinout, SMBJ20AHM3_B/H application, or SMBJ20AHM3_B/H equivalent, key selection criteria include unidirectional polarity, AEC-Q101 qualification status, halogen-free RoHS compliance (HM3 suffix), thermal resistance (RθJA = 100 °C/W), and junction temperature range (–55 °C to +150 °C).
Technical Context
This TVS diode operates as a voltage-clamping protection device in series with sensitive downstream circuitry. Its glass-passivated junction enables fast response time (<1 ns), low incremental surge resistance, and stable clamping under repetitive 10/1000 µs transients at 0.01% duty cycle.
The SMBJ20AHM3_B/H is rated for 100 A non-repetitive forward surge current (IFSM) and exhibits a positive temperature coefficient of VBR (+0.094 %/°C), ensuring predictable voltage shift across operating temperature. It meets J-STD-020 MSL Level 1 and JEDEC JESD201 Class 2 whisker resistance requirements.

FAQ
What is the breakdown voltage tolerance for SMBJ20AHM3_B/H?
The SMBJ20AHM3_B/H has a minimum breakdown voltage (VBR) of 22.2 V and maximum of 24.5 V at 10 mA test current, yielding a ±5.2% tolerance band. This tight specification ensures consistent clamping behavior across production lots and supports precise overvoltage margin allocation in safety-critical designs.
Is SMBJ20AHM3_B/H suitable for bidirectional transient protection?
No - SMBJ20AHM3_B/H is a unidirectional TVS diode, marked with a cathode band and intended for use with defined polarity. For bidirectional protection, Vishay specifies CA-suffix variants (e.g., SMBJ20CA); using SMBJ20AHM3_B/H in reverse-biased configurations risks permanent junction damage due to lack of symmetrical avalanche capability.
Does SMBJ20AHM3_B/H meet automotive qualification standards?
Yes - the HM3 suffix confirms SMBJ20AHM3_B/H is halogen-free, RoHS-compliant, and AEC-Q101 qualified. It has passed stress tests including high-temperature reverse bias (HTRB), temperature cycling, and ESD per AEC-Q101 Rev D, making it approved for use in engine control units, body electronics, and ADAS sensor modules.
What is the maximum clamping voltage of SMBJ20AHM3_B/H under surge conditions?
The SMBJ20AHM3_B/H clamps to a maximum of 32.4 V at its rated peak pulse current of 18.5 A (10/1000 µs waveform). This value is guaranteed per datasheet Table 1 and verified across temperature range –55 °C to +150 °C, enabling accurate worst-case overvoltage analysis in protected circuit design.
How does the thermal resistance of SMBJ20AHM3_B/H affect PCB layout?
SMBJ20AHM3_B/H has RθJA = 100 °C/W, meaning 1 W of dissipated power raises junction temperature by 100 °C above ambient. To maintain TJ ≤ 150 °C at 50 °C ambient, keep average power below 1 W - achieved via adequate copper pad area (0.2" × 0.2" per terminal) and avoid dense thermal islands under the SMB package.
